Team Jerry Pounds - Top Performing Mortgage Loan Officer HOW BUILDING A STRONG REVIEW FOOTPRINT WITH AN EMAIL CAMPAIGN IMPROVES SEARCH AND AI DISCOVERABILITY OVER TIME
Background:I developed an email campaign for Jerry Pounds, a Pittsburgh-based mortgage loan officer, designed to improve his visibility in search and emerging GenAI platforms such as ChatGPT and Copilot.
Because mortgage professionals cannot directly solicit five-star reviews, I created a campaign called “Surprise Jerry.” The concept invited past clients and industry partners to leave honest Google reviews to help strengthen Jerry’s online reputation and improve search visibility.
The campaign used targeted email segments for both past clients and professional partners such as Realtors and title agents. Emails included suggested prompts that naturally incorporated location and industry keywords, helping strengthen Jerry’s SEO footprint.

Results:The campaign delivered strong engagement across both audiences, with open rates as high as 77.5 percent and click rates exceeding 22 percent.
As a result, Jerry’s Google reviews grew from 5 to 32, significantly strengthening his online authority. His name now appears in ChatGPT search results for top mortgage professionals in Pittsburgh, demonstrating how reputation-focused email campaigns can directly influence modern search visibility.
This case study highlights the impact of treating online reputation as a strategic search asset. By designing a campaign that encouraged authentic client feedback and incorporated natural location and industry language, Jerry’s review footprint grew into a powerful signal of credibility across the web. As those signals accumulated, so did his visibility, demonstrating how a consistent review strategy can strengthen authority in both traditional search and emerging AI platforms.
